A restaurant for the upper-class--ONLY
We went to this restaurant to reward ourselves of all the work we had done to try and get back on our feet after Katrina. We were given small pieces of beef (inappropriately called 'tor-nah-does')
cooked wrong twice...and snotty service by the waiter. It cost $80 for the meal...we left upset and felt we had been treated very shabbily. Of course, we looked a bit shabby as well. No clean water in New Orleans...and cleaning our apartment out the past 3 days. But we went hoping for nice atmosphere and good food...and an overall good experience. What we got was one good dish, horrible atmosphere, and an overall horrible experience.

Afterwards, we went to K-Paul's where Paul Prudomme was sitting outside with a jazz band he had hired. The atmosphere was lively and joyous...

I've had the food at K-Paul's and it was delicious. If only we would have found it before our rotton experience at Muriel's... - Shannon , posted 10/27/05
